**Minutes — Management Meeting, Training Budget**

Prepared for the incoming director of Tollgrave Manufacturing. Attendees agreed next year's training budget rises modestly, prioritising machine-safety refreshers at the Wrenhollow plant and supervisor courses led by Dalia Mercuth. External workshops are deferred pending Q2 results. Approval votes passed unanimously. The rationale behind these allocations depends on the confidential business note appended below.

management briefing: Only 7 of the 80 pilot accounts renewed Ralath, so a churn review is set for July 1.

Changed defaults in Splitfork, our assignment service. Bucketing now uses sticky hashing per account instead of per session, and the holdout slice grew from 2% to 5%. Callers relying on session-level reassignment must opt in explicitly. Review the diff against the new baseline; the updated default configuration is listed below.

config for tagep-kajof:
[casir]
port = 6379
region = south-1
host = casir.paliqdyn.example
team = tamax
timeout_ms = 250
retries = 2

Dear Soren, handing over the Marrowfield diff viewer release. The chunked renderer now streams files above 200 MB without loading them fully into memory; please review the bounds checks in the chunk loader. All artifacts are staged and checksummed. For your verification, the release signing key follows below.

release key, hagug-yaguf: bky13_NnhXrmFGhCRtW

## Authentication

The Marrowtide SDKs for Kestrel and Pavane now have full feature parity for auth flows: token refresh, scoped credentials, and retry-on-expiry behave identically in both clients. New contractors should test against the sandbox environment first; production keys are provisioned separately by the platform team. To run the sandbox integration suite, export the bearer token shown below.

session JWT of yawep-yawep = eyJhbGciOiJIUzI1NiIsInR5cCI6IkpXVCJ9.eyJzdWIiOiI3pWF3_In0.aXYsHiog